How could I lose the garrison when I was three times bigger army?
The size of an army doesn't determine its strength, it's all about finding the right balance. The first line of your army (~9100 cavalry units at that moment) fled from the battle in round 10, after their morale went down to 44. The remaining army was no match for the enemy garrison army and was pretty much slaughtered. So everything b_mad said is correct.

I see 10 rounds fled from the field, but I do not see that morale was 44.
Maybe visualization is not good but I see 10 rounds morale 77?

There's a known bug concerning the visualization of the morale indeed. The morale of 77 you see is the average morale of all three lines.

This was the actual morale of the 3 lines at the beginning of round 10:
Line 1: 51 (Loses 7 morale and flees)
Line 2: 102 (Loses 1 morale)
Line 3: 78 (Loses 4 morale)
